WebbQualified dependents must be declared by the principal member. Their names must be listed under the principal member's Member Data Record (MDR) to ensure hassle-free benefits availment. © 2014 Philippine Health Insurance Corporation Citystate Centre, …
Webb29 mars 2011 · So if you have a big family and you and your spouse are members of PhilHealth, come up with a plan on how to declare your dependents. If you have, lets say 2 children, then both members can declare one child so as to maximize the 45 days allowable period for the dependents.
WebbIf the member is single and without children, the benefits will go to the dependent parents who are considered the secondary beneficiaries.
